I assume that at some point prices will normalize again. But my assumption is that the feed back loop of the free market also has a time delay and needs time to self-correct and I guess this time delay can be longer than expected. Especially when supply chains are disrupted, for many products customers often cannot simply switch to a competitor. Covid kind of "broke" the free market, and it will heal itself, but it takes longer than expected.
